Objective: Intrathyroidal lymphoid infiltrate (TLI) may show qualitative and quantitative differences in Hashimoto thyroiditis (HT); thyroidal functional status (TFS) may differ among HT patients. The aim of this study has been to evaluate TLI in different TFS of HT.Methods: Flow-cytometry (FC) was applied to thyroidal fine-needle cytology samples (FNC) in 23 patients. TLI was analyzed using the following fluoresceinated antibodies: CD3, CD4, CD5, CD8, CD10, CD19, CD25, CD69, CD95 (FAS). TFS was determined by serum TSH, FT3, FT4 immunoassays, in specific clinical settings, to classify the patients as euthyroid (16) and hypothyroid (7). Pearson's correlation coefficient was used to evaluate possible correlations between CD4/CD8 ratio, CD4+ CD25+ CD69-: regulatory T (Treg) cells proportion, CD95 expression and TFS.Results: B-lymphocytes (CD19+, CD10±, CD5-, CD3-) were present in 18 cases, T-lymphocytes (CD19-, CD10-, CD5+, CD3+) in all the cases. CD4/CD8≥2:1 ratio was observed in 16 euthyroid and 3 hypothyroid; CD4/CD8≤1:1 ratio in none of euthyroid and in 4 hypothyroid. CD4+ CD25+ CD69- Treg cells proportion was lower in hypothyroid than in the euthyroid patients; CD4+, CD25+, CD95(FAS)+ were mainly expressed in hypothyroidism. Statistical analysis did not demonstrate associations among CD4/CD8 ratios, Treg cells proportions and CD95 expression in the two TFS. Conclusions: FNC may be used to assess TLI in HT. Intrathyroidal CD4/CD8 ≤ 1:1 ratio, CD4+, CD25+, CD69- cells reduction and CD95(FAS)+ are expression of Treg cells apoptosis and might be related to intense thyroidal damage and risk of hypothyroidism. Further studies are needed to assess their possible prognostic significance.
